The Diocese of Caacupé is a Latin Church diocese in Paraguay, originating as a territorial prelature in 1960 and promoted to a diocese in 1967, suffragan to the Archdiocese of Asunción. Its see is the national shrine and minor basilica of Our Lady of Miracles, and it is led by Bishop Ricardo Valenzuela Ríos.
